DESCRIPTION: Prediabetes is a disease in and of itself, associated with early damage to the eyes, kidneys, and heart. The explosion of diabetes in children is a result of our epidemic of childhood obesity, which may be stemmed with a plant-based diet, given that vegetarian kids grow up not only taller, but thinner.
